Ich


I came home tonight to see my bicolor angel covered with white spots. The other fish look fine, for now. I have only 1 tank set up right now, and don't have much extra water laying around. Anything you can suggest I do? It is in a 46 gallon reef with 3 other fish, and they seem to be doing fine. I have a small 10 gallon I could set up tommorrow for it, and treat it in that. The only filter I have for it is a whisper power filter. Just pull the carbon out? Otherwise, I'm stuck with pulling the fish out and putting it out of misery. Let me know what you would do.

Ich is usually cuased by a fish stressing out. Thier are sever ways to cure it and prevent it. The best way at thid moment in time would be to set up a hospital tank and put the angel in it. Wilth this tank you could use treatments such as copper or even better Hypo salinity. For preventative measures in the future a garlic additive in the foods you feed seems to work well, that and maybe Selicon (vitamins).

Being somewhat of a skeptic of garlic I was reluctant to try it until I changed tanks, had an ich outbreak , and was unable to catch the infected fish. I'm happy to report it did work and is a weekly addition to my blender mush now as a preventative measuse. I also reconnected my uv sterilizer and never shut it off now. (There are 2 schools of thought on this but it works for me)
